About Iochroma fuchsioides (Kunth) Miers

Iochroma fuchsioides (Kunth) Miers is a species belonging to the genus Iochroma. It is native to Ecuador and Colombia, and was first formally described in 1848. Along with the already documented compound withanolide D, three previously unknown withanolides have been isolated from this species.
